Houghton County Property Taxes (Michigan)

Houghton County Treasurers and Tax Collectors are responsible for the collection of tax revenue through collecting property taxes in Houghton County, MI. The Office of the Treasurer and Tax Collector maintains current data on every parcel in the district, as well as a number of other tax payment records. These Houghton County public tax records include property tax assessments, defaults on property taxes, and property valuations. The Treasurer and Tax Collector may also maintain information on local tax payments, property auctions, and a property's prior liens or foreclosures. Houghton County Treasurers and Tax Collectors provide online databases to access tax payment records.
